Ben Frost Neglects the Scope

2024-01-18 by Free Death #2 | 5 Comments
Harsh-electro engineer Ben Frost has announced his first studio album since 2017’s The Centre Cannot Hold. Titled Scope Neglect, the record is scheduled for March 1st and two songs are available to stream ahead of time.

So Ben's concert I saw in Prague on Friday was quite weird. I didn't get what parts of it were intentionally weird and to what extent was it random because it was the first show of the project ever. For most of the time, Ben was doing his usual droney stuff while Greg was doing some kinds of extremely loud random djent Adam-Jones-doing-soundcheck riffs for like 80 minutes straight. I'd be far more into Ben's collab with some doom or sludge guitarist, this modern progressive metal thing was a little bizzare. But I get it that he probably wanted to explore some new musical territories. It still had its moments which were pretty massive. I'm quite curious how the album will sound like.
